CollegeInvest's Stable Value Plus Maintains Country's Second Highest Rate of Return
Denver, Colorado (PRWEB) December 09, 2016 -- CollegeInvest announced today that Stable Value Plus, its guaranteed fixed-income 529 college savings plan, is holding its position offering the second highest rate of return for stable value accounts in the country. A rate increase effective December 1, 2016, provides earnings of 2.59 percent, net of all fees.
Stable Value Plus is one of four 529 college savings options offered by CollegeInvest, which boasts one of the most diverse menus of savings options anywhere in the country. Stable Value Plus provides a guaranteed annual rate of return and can be opened with as little as $25, making the plan an extremely popular choice among Colorado families who are saving for college.
More CollegeInvest account holders are placing their college savings in Stable Value Plus accounts than ever before. Over the past three years, the number of Stable Value Plus accounts has increased by 46 percent and assets have more than doubled.

About CollegeInvest
CollegeInvest is Colorado’s foremost resource designed specifically to help break down the financial barriers to attaining a higher education or vocational training. By providing expert information, easy-to-use planning tools, and an exceptionally diverse menu of tax advantaged college savings plans, CollegeInvest works to help Coloradans maximize their potential to save for college. CollegeInvest currently represents $6.6 billion in savings, and more than 350,000 accounts, the majority of which are held by Colorado residents. Money saved in a CollegeInvest 529 savings plan can be used at any public or private college, university, community college or vocational school, anywhere in the country.
